New E39 M5 owner in Kelowna, BC

This thread is timely as I have just returned from a trip to San Francisco with my 2002 E39 M5. I have owned a 1991 M5 for 11 years ( still have it, now wife's car) and felt it was time for something a little newer and faster.

Did 1325 miles up the California/Oregon coasts with it and enjoyed every mile ! Even after all trip costs including taxes and duties...I'm still about $14,000 ahead from what the local dealer wanted for a 2001 !!

Just ordered a Britalman exhaust for it to make it a little "throatier" and am considering the SS headers and a set of Konis ( they did wonders for my '91)

If you guys want an M...the time is NOW..with the Canadian dollar the way it is !!
